How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Walkers Point?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Walkers Point Studio Apartments | $1,457 | $1,190 | $2,041 |
| Walkers Point 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,362 | $506 | $2,710 |
Walkers Point 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,688 | $604 | $4,031 |
| Walkers Point 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,405 | $1,271 | $4,185 |
